It could be normal urinary byproducts. I would have your vet run an urinalysis if you are concerned. Make sure the urine is freshly evaluated, I've had crystals show up in samples simply from urine sitting around and precipitating out of solution. May vets can do this in house, but if it is going to be sent out, I try to have morning appointments.
